If the MAF sensor sends an erroneous signal, a few things happen. The engine's computer will trigger the check engine light, and the on-board diagnostic (OBD) trouble codes will reflect the airflow discrepancy noted by the MAF sensor. Depending on the reported volume of air, the engine may try to compensate for these conditions, causing the engine to burn excessive amounts of fuel and emit black smoke from the exhaust. In this case, the OBD trouble codes would also reference faults recognized by the exhaust oxygen sensors. The engine may also have issues with idling roughly, failing to start, stalling, hesitation, power loss, misfires, and fuel consumption.
When troubleshooting engine stalling issues in a 1999 Volkswagen Passat, it's essential to adopt a systematic diagnostic approach that begins with the most straightforward checks. Start by examining the fuel system to ensure that fuel is adequately reaching the engine; this includes inspecting the fuel pump, filter, and injectors for any blockages or failures. Next, turn your attention to the ignition system, where checking the condition of spark plugs, ignition coils, and cables is crucial for ensuring proper spark delivery. Following this, assess the air intake system by inspecting the air filter for clogs and checking the throttle body for obstructions that could hinder airflow. Utilizing an OBD-II scanner to scan for error codes can provide insights into potential sensor or component issues that may be contributing to the stalling. Additionally, checking for vacuum leaks in hoses and connections is vital, as these can disrupt the air-fuel mixture and lead to performance problems. Lastly, verify the functionality of the engine coolant temperature sensor, as a malfunctioning sensor can result in an incorrect fuel mixture. By methodically addressing these areas, you can effectively diagnose and resolve the stalling issue, ensuring your Passat runs smoothly.
When diagnosing engine stalling in a 1999 Volkswagen Passat, it's essential to consider several common problems that could be at play. A faulty mass airflow sensor is often a primary culprit, as it can disrupt the delicate balance of air and fuel entering the engine, leading to stalling. Additionally, issues with the fuel pump, such as inadequate fuel pressure or a failing unit, can prevent the engine from receiving the necessary fuel, resulting in stalling. The ignition system also plays a critical role; faulty spark plugs or a malfunctioning ignition coil can lead to misfires and engine shutdowns. Furthermore, vacuum leaks can significantly impact engine performance by altering the air intake, which may cause stalling. Lastly, dirty or clogged fuel injectors can hinder proper fuel delivery, exacerbating the stalling issue. By understanding these common causes, DIYers can take proactive steps in troubleshooting and maintaining their vehicle, ensuring a smoother and more reliable driving experience.

A faulty oxygen sensor is one of the most common causes of a check engine light. Symptoms may include a decrease in fuel mileage, hesitation or misfiring from the engine, rough idling or even stalling. A faulty sensor may cause the vehicle to fail an emissions test.
Any time there is an emissions fault the check engine light will be displayed. The purpose of the check engine light is to inform the driver that an emission related fault has been found, and that there are on-board diagnostic (OBD) trouble codes stored in the powertrain or engine control module. Additionally, since the emissions systems are so intertwined into engine control and transmission control systems, symptoms may include nearly any sort of drivability concerns. This may include harsh shifting, failure to shift, hesitation on acceleration, jerking, engine failure to start or run, loss of power, or any number of other drivability issues.
When the Check Engine Light comes on, you may experience engine performance issues such as poor acceleration, rough idling, or an engine that won't start. In some cases, no abnormal symptoms will be experienced. Other systems like the transmission or ABS can cause the Check Engine Light to illuminate and lights for those systems can come on at the same time. Similar lights may say "Check Engine Soon", "Malfunction Indicator Light" or just "Check". In rare case the engine can overheat.
